WebGreenland is currently experiencing negative population growth of -0.1% annually, with a fertility rate of 2.1 births per woman, which is below the replacement level. The current population of Greenland is 56,606 based on projections of the latest United Nations data. The UN estimates the July 1, 2024 population at 56,643. WebMost notable are the Nordic countries of Europe. Norway, Sweden, Denmark, Iceland, and Finland are not only among Europe's safest countries, they are among the top 25 safest countries anywhere on Earth. As such, this region is considered the safest in the world. The homicide rate in this region is 0.8 incidences per 100,000 inhabitants. WebInformation about crime in Greenland.
